Flood warnings remain in place in Bury as river levels still high

Don't miss a thing that's happening in and around Bury by signing up to the free MyBury newsletterFlood warnings remain in place in Bury after Storm Christoph triggered a ‘major incident’ in Greater Manchester.Several properties could be flooded in Radcliffe following days of heavy rainfall.Warnings are currently in force for homes at Pioneer Mills, Parkside Close and Close Park.Water levels at the River Irwell at Strongstry are also rising and are expected to remain high until Friday (January

BREAKING: Zak Bennett-Eko guilty of manslaughter by diminished responsibility after throwing baby son into River Irwell

Zak Bennett-Eko flung his son, Zakari William Bennett-Eko, into the River Irwell in Radcliffe on September 11, 2019. After the baby boy's body was pulled from the water, he was found to have died from hypothermia, drowning, or a combination of the two.

First look at the family homes that will form part of Salford's new £120m neighbourhood

Salboy are behind the £120m Castle Irwell project, which will see 500 family homes built on a brand new neighbourhood in Salford. The development is set on land surrounded by the River Irwell which was once the site of Manchester Racecourse.

'State-of-the-art' solar farm and new hydroelectric schemes will power 638 homes

A 'state-of-the-art' solar farm and new hydro-electric schemes in the River Irwell will soon power 638 homes.A total of 5,094 solar panels are planned for a plot of coarse grassland west of Kenyon Way in Little Hulton, with work set to start on site by summer 2021.The work will take approximately five months to complete, after which the solar farm is expected to generate enough electricity for 438 homes a year.Salford council has also put forward plans for a hydro-electric installation at
